Both colleges are quite good.The nirf ranking of NIE mysore is 175.Information science engineering is similar to computer science engineering.Infrastructure and academics of this college is good .Nearly 90% of the students got placed in different companies.The average salary package offered was 7 LPA.Faculty is very well experienced and highly qualified.
The nirf ranking of Ramaih institute of technology is 59.The total fee structure of BE/BTECH in this college is 3.74L.Nearly 80% of the students got placed in different companies.The average salary package offered was 4 LPA.Faculty is very well experienced and highly qualified. Nitte Meenakshi Institute of Technology, Karnataka -
Highest packages offered in the last year was 27lacs per annum.
Average salary offered was around 3.50LPA.
Major recruiting companies are Infosys, Wipro, Nutanix etc.
The college also has good placement percentage in cse department.
The National Institute of Engineering,Mysore Karnataka-
Highest package offered was 46.5LPA
The college has good training and placement cell which organises several training activities for the students.
The average salary package offered was 4.23 LPA
The major recruiting companies are Amazon, Bosch, Mercedes Benz etc.

If we go through previous year data at the end of round 2, then closing rank for CSE in The National Institute of Engineering and Siddaganga Institute of Technology was 4517 and 5713 respectively for general merit, but remember that cutoffs vary every year based on multiple factors such as seat matrix, marks obtained in exam, toughness level of paper, total number of candidates participating in the exam etc, check out previous year cut-offs at https://engineering.careers360.com/articles/comedk-uget-cutoff
